Output 66a3e0686384ec6c035dae8a8d923b9d75df12e65cb35ae3ff9eecdfd9755b8e:0

value
188000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c8b6a83a3b6c7fecf77733eaad5005a911e6638 OP_EQUALVERIFY OP_CHECKSIG
address
1CMXoaxLvB7J7VTBD4NNHNdZR9BtKyAnJY
transaction
66a3e0686384ec6c035dae8a8d923b9d75df12e65cb35ae3ff9eecdfd9755b8e
confirmations
416852
spent
true